Taking care of them is expensive though! On Thursday I bought another Fluval 4plus filter for Betsy's tank. The day after John, Robbie and Luis helped clean the tank and change the water, it was still GREEN! I will go into school tomorrow. Hopefully the water won't be as green anymore. I also had to get another heating lamp light bulb. The other one burned out. These bulbs are important because they make heat for Betsy to bask under AND they are full-spectrum lights which is important for Betsy's physical and psychological health.
